McNeese vs. Tougaloo College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, McNeese or Tougaloo College?

  • Tougaloo College is 101.7% more expensive to attend than McNeese for in-state tuition ($10,384.00 vs. $5,147.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 56.2% higher at Tougaloo College than McNeese State University ($10,384.00 vs. $6,647.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at McNeese State University than Tougaloo College ($10,154 vs. $13,718)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Tougaloo College are 54.3% lower than costs at McNeese State University ($6,400 vs. $9,878)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Tougaloo College than McNeese State University (90% vs. 88%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by McNeese State University students is 1.6% larger than aid received Tougaloo College ($9,540 vs. $9,387)

McNeese vs. Tougaloo College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, McNeese or Tougaloo College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Tougaloo College and McNeese.

  • The graduation rate at Tougaloo College is higher than McNeese State University (48% vs. 37%)
  • Graduates from McNeese State University earn on average $14,400 more per year than Tougaloo College graduates after ten years. ($44,000 vs. $29,600)
  • McNeese State University students graduate with a $14,766 lower median federal student loan debt than Tougaloo College graduates. ($20,238 vs. $35,004)
  • McNeese graduates are paying $152 less per month on federal student loans than Tougaloo College graduates. ($209 vs. $361)
  • More McNeese gra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Tougaloo College students, three years after graduation. (49% vs. 39%)
